原文:MongoDB 中聚合統計計算--$SUM表達式

我們一般通過表達式 sum來計算總和。因為MongoDB的文檔有數組字段,所以可以簡單的將計算總和分成兩種: ,統計符合條件的所有文檔的某個字段的總和 ,統計每個文檔的數組字段里面的各個數據值的和。這兩種情況都可以通過 sum表達式來完成。以上兩種情況的聚合統計,分別對應與聚合框架中的 group操作步驟和 project操作步驟。 . group 直接看例子吧。 Case 測試集合mycol中的 ...

2019-08-23 15:57 0 5925 推薦指數:

查看詳情

MongoDB 聚合(管道與表達式)

  MongoDB聚合(aggregate)主要用於處理數據(諸如統計平均值,求和等),並返回計算后的數據結果。有點類似sql語句中的 count(*)。 aggregate() 方法 MongoDB聚合的方法使用aggregate()。 語法 aggregate() 方法的基本語法 ...

Tue Mar 27 01:54:00 CST 2018 0 3091
Lambda表達式-聚合操作

文章參考自博客:https://www.cnblogs.com/franson-2016/p/5593080.html 以及學習網站:how2java.cn 1.傳統方式和聚合操作遍歷數據的不同 傳統遍歷List的方式如下: 而使用了聚合操作的方式 ...

Wed Mar 20 02:45:00 CST 2019 0 789
前綴表達式計算

前綴表達式計算 前面我們曾對《后綴表達式計算》做過討論。后綴表達式計算過程是首先設定一個操作數棧,順序掃描整個后綴表達式,如果遇到操作數,則將操作數壓棧;如果遇到操作符,則從操作數棧中彈出相應的操作數進行運算,並將運算結果進行壓棧。當將整個后綴表達式掃描完畢時,操作數棧 ...

Mon Sep 23 06:55:00 CST 2013 0 7852
表達式計算 java 后綴表達式

題目: 問題描述   輸入一個只包含加減乖除和括號的合法表達式,求表達式的值。其中除表示整除。 輸入格式   輸入一行,包含一個表達式。 輸出格式   輸出這個表達式的值。 樣例輸入 1-2+3*(4-5) 樣例輸出 ...

Tue Mar 14 05:21:00 CST 2017 0 6537
mysql的count和sum使用條件表達式

count函數條件不為null的時候顯示結果。即使為false也也會顯示結果。 可以是使用if條件或者case when語句。如果條件不為null即需要的結果。 使用count()函數實現條件統計的基礎是對於值為NULL的記錄不計數,常用的有以下三種方式,假設統計num大於200的記錄 ...

Mon Jun 24 05:09:00 CST 2019 0 917
mongodb 正則表達式

查詢以 李 開頭的 db.student.find({name:/^李/}) 查詢英文的 姓名 db.student.find({name:/^[a-zA-Z]{2,10}$/}) ...

Tue Aug 27 00:48:00 CST 2019 0 560
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M